I wouldn’t recommend the Cetus kit, the controller is awful, the goggles are bad, and the drone is meh. The BetaFPV air65 and 75 are quite good though. For the controller, something from Radiomaster or Jumper with ELRS.

Don’t get the Cetus kit, the drone help community I’m in has seen many people being pushed out of the hobby because of how much the literadio sucks, and the drone itself is quite meh. The BetaFPV air65 and 75 are better options. But yeah, get a sim first. You should train like you fly and fly like you train, so use the same radio controller you’d use for the real drone. I recommend the Radiomaster pocket or boxer. Specifically the ELRS version, not cc2500 or 4-in-1.
